Output 4baefacbbc99e11ff38415bfb1a13ed06a65b9f5e01de7c73b2c91ca7da32011:0

value
91542
script pubkey
OP_0 OP_PUSHBYTES_20 31c456738d8b7b0f4d750c4a9901c5789220c377
address
bc1qx8z9vuud3das7nt4p39fjqw90zfzpsmhdwfsrc
transaction
4baefacbbc99e11ff38415bfb1a13ed06a65b9f5e01de7c73b2c91ca7da32011
confirmations
124107
spent
true